Best areas to stay in Warsaw

Choosing the right place to stay can make or break your trip to Warsaw. Whether you're a first-time visitor, a budget traveler, or planning a longer stay with family, there are several key factors to consider when selecting an area that suits your needs.

Best area for first-time visitors

If this is your first time in Warsaw, it's wise to base yourself in central areas like the Old Town (Stare Miasto) or the Royal Route. These neighborhoods are rich with history and offer easy access to major attractions such as the Palace of Culture and Science, the Barbican, and the Royal Castle. Staying here ensures you won't miss out on any of Warsaw's iconic sights.

Best area for budget travelers

Budget-conscious visitors often find that areas like Praga Południe or Wola offer more affordable accommodation options while still being within reach of public transportation to the city center. These neighborhoods are a bit further from the main tourist spots but provide a glimpse into everyday Warsaw life and can be quite charming in their own right.

Best area for families

Families might prefer quieter, safer areas like Ursynów or Bemowo. These districts offer more spacious accommodations and parks where children can play safely. They are also close to supermarkets and family-friendly restaurants, making them ideal for longer stays with kids.

Best area for short stays

For those planning a brief visit, staying in central areas like Śródmieście or Mokotów is highly recommended due to their excellent transport links. These neighborhoods are well-connected by metro and bus services, allowing you to explore the city efficiently without worrying about long commutes.

Best area for longer stays

If you're planning a more extended stay in Warsaw, consider areas like Ursynów or Bemowo. These districts offer comfortable living conditions with easy access to supermarkets and other amenities. They are also quieter than the city center, providing a peaceful environment that's perfect for settling into life in Warsaw.

How to choose the right area

  • Trip length: Short-term visitors might prefer central locations with easy access to attractions and public transport. Longer stays may benefit from quieter areas closer to amenities like supermarkets and parks.
  • Budget: Central areas tend to be more expensive, while neighborhoods further out offer better value for money but still provide good connections to the city center.
  • Transport needs: Areas with good public transport links are ideal if you plan to explore widely. If you prefer walking or cycling, consider staying in a pedestrian-friendly area.
  • Travel style: Those interested in history and culture might enjoy central areas like the Old Town, while those looking for modern amenities and nightlife may find Śródmieście more appealing.
